RepGen - Automated Bug Reproduction

Overview

RepGen is a production-grade tool that leverages state-of-the-art Large Language Models (LLMs) to automatically reproduce bugs in software libraries. By analyzing bug reports and repository context, RepGen plans a reproduction strategy and generates executable Python scripts to replicate the issue.

Ideally suited for Deep Learning libraries, RepGen automates the tedious first step of debugging: creating a Minimum Reproducible Example (MRE).

Features

  • Smart Retrieval: Uses hybrid search (BM25 + Semantic) to find relevant code snippets and training loops for context.
  • Multi-Backend Support: Seamlessly switch between LLM providers:
    • Ollama: Run locally with models like qwen2.5-coder, llama3, or mistral.
    • OpenAI: Utilize gpt-4o and gpt-3.5-turbo for high-precision generation.
    • Gemini & Claude: leverage multimodal and reasoning capabilities.
  • Remote Input Handling:
    • Direct support for GitHub Issue URLs (fetches content via API).
    • Direct support for Git Repository URLs (clones automatically to temp workspace).
  • Professional VS Code Extension: A fully integrated sidebar to run reproductions directly in your editor.
  • Docker Ready: Full containerization for easy deployment.

Quick Start

The easiest way to run RepGen is using Docker. This ensures a consistent environment with all dependencies pre-installed.

# 1. Build the image
cd RepGen
docker build -t repgen .

# 2. Run the server (mounting the volume for development if needed)
docker run -p 8000:8000 repgen

The API will be available at http://localhost:8000.


Developer Setup

If you prefer to run locally or contribute to the core logic:

# 1. Create a virtual environment
python3 -m venv venv
source venv/bin/activate  # On Windows: .\venv\Scripts\activate

# 2. Install RepGen in editable mode
pip install -e .

# 3. Run the CLI
repgen

Usage Examples

CLI Automation

repgen \
  --bug-report https://github.com/owner/repo/issues/123 \
  --repo-path https://github.com/owner/repo.git \
  --backend openai \
  --model gpt-4o

Configuration

Set API keys via environment variables:

export OPENAI_API_KEY="sk-..."
export GEMINI_API_KEY="AIza..."

Future Work and Research Directions

  1. Scalable Execution via Cluster Schedulers Integrate RepGen with workload managers such as SLURM to offload reproduction tasks to HPC or GPU clusters. This would enable asynchronous execution, queue-based scheduling, and automated user notifications once reproduction artifacts are ready.

  2. Automated Verification in Isolated Sandboxes Extend RepGen with sandboxed execution environments that automatically validate whether a generated reproduction script successfully triggers the reported bug. This would close the loop between generation and confirmation.

  3. Bug-Type–Aware Verification Strategies Develop specialized verification mechanisms tailored to different bug classes (e.g., crashes, numerical instability, performance regressions, nondeterministic failures). Each class may require distinct success criteria and instrumentation.

  4. Fine-Grained Bug Localization and Understanding Move beyond reproduction toward bug comprehension, including identifying the most likely fault-inducing components, APIs, or configuration parameters involved in the failure.

  5. Understanding Practitioner Adoption Barriers Read papers about why practitioners underutilize automated debugging tools, and insights from these papers can guide usability improvements and feature prioritization.

  6. CI/CD and GitHub Actions Integration Integrate RepGen directly into GitHub Actions and other CI pipelines, enabling automated bug reproduction as part of issue triage, regression testing, or pull request validation workflows.
